当前位置: 科技先知道 » 其他综合 » 经验分享 » 揭秘JavaScript常见错误及其解决方案

揭秘JavaScript常见错误及其解决方案

简介: JavaScript是当今最流行的编程语言之一,但在使用过程中可能会遇到一些常见的错误。本文将深入分析几种常见的JavaScript错误,并提供相应的解决方案。


在日常的编程过程中,可能会遇到一些常见的JavaScript错误。了解这些错误及其解决方案,能帮助我们更有效地编写代码。以下是几种常见的JavaScript错误及其解决方案:

1. ReferenceError:

错误示例:

javascript

console.log(nonExistentVariable);

解决方案: 确保变量已经被正确地声明和初始化。

2. TypeError:

错误示例:

javascript

null.f();

解决方案: 在尝试访问对象的属性或方法之前,确保对象存在。

3. SyntaxError:

错误示例:

javascript

function () {};

解决方案: 检查语法,确保所有的括号、逗号和语句都正确无误。

4. RangeError:

错误示例:

javascript

function foo() { foo(); } foo();

解决方案: 避免无限递归、循环或者其他可能导致堆栈溢出的操作。

5. URIError:

错误示例:

javascript

decodeURIComponent('%');

解决方案: 确保URI组件的编码和解码操作正确无误。

通过深入理解这些常见的JavaScript错误及其解决方案,我们可以减少编程过程中的挫折,提高编码效率。同时,还能够更好地理解JavaScript语言的运作机制,为我们日后的编程项目奠定坚实的基础。

未经允许不得转载:科技先知道 » 揭秘JavaScript常见错误及其解决方案

相关文章

My title